IQVIA Clinical Data Scientist in Durham, North Carolina

Location: Home-based in the U.S. or Canada

Summary: IQVIA is seeking a Clinical Data Scientist, at the Senior level, to join an Advanced Analytics group within a Clinical Data Science department. Join our team that is dedicated to the long-term efforts of a prominent Pharmaceutical company. Work fully within the environment of the Pharma.

Collaborate with other scientists and engineers to leverage machine learning methods and algorithms for modeling and analysis of clinical operations and clinical trials data.

Responsibilities:

  • Design, implement, test, deploy and maintain innovative data and machine learning solutions to improve clinical operations.

  • Create experiments and prototype implementations of new learning algorithms and prediction techniques.

  • Collaborate with scientists, engineers, product managers and business stakeholders to design and implement software solutions.

  • Use machine learning best practices to ensure a high standard of quality for all of the team deliverables.

  • SQL Query Assistance: Assist in crafting SQL queries to extract data from individual or multiple, large databases. Experience with PostgreSQL is a plus.

  • Optimizing Database and Query Performance: Develop materialized views and implement indexing strategies to enhance query speed and ensure efficient execution of application-specific queries. Write efficient queries that don’t require materialized view creation when possible.

  • Data Quality Monitoring: Help establish a robust data quality monitoring framework for early detection and resolution of data quality issues following bulk data loads.

  • Database Documentation Maintenance: Maintain and develop comprehensive database documentation for other users and data scientists.

Qualifications:

  • Bachelor's degree or higher in Computer Science, Data Science, or related field. Working experience will be considered in lieu of a related educational degree.

  • Proven experience as a Data Scientist in the areas of life sciences, clinical trials.

  • Develop effective data science solutions by applying ML/AI (deep learning, NLP, Causal inference methods) to deliver business value.

  • Strong knowledge of SQL, database structures, schema design, and query tuning principles, and practices.

  • Proficient in machine learning, information retrieval, and applied statistics.

  • Ability to do exploratory analysis on large volumes of data and find key descriptive and inferential properties.

  • Familiarity with Python is also necessary.

  • Familiarity with data quality monitoring and data preparation techniques.

  • Familiarity with the pharmaceutical industry and clinical data is strongly preferred.
